At its core, the appeal of racing games lies in their dynamic gameplay and the adrenaline rush they provide. Players are often placed behind the wheel of a high-performance vehicle, tasked with navigating intricate tracks and mastering hairpin turns to outpace their competitors. The genre covers a wide spectrum, from the brutally realistic to the charmingly fantastical, and it is this diversity that keeps players coming back for more.

Simulation-style racing games such as 'Gran Turismo' and 'Forza Motorsport' cater to enthusiasts who appreciate meticulous attention to detail. These games offer lifelike graphics and physics, with developers going to great lengths to recreate real-world driving experiences. They often include an impressive array of licensed cars, accurately modeled after their real-world counterparts, and tracks that mirror famous racing circuits. These simulators provide a challenging and immersive experience for those who relish fine-tuning their strategy to shave a few milliseconds off their lap times.

Conversely, arcade-style racers like 'Mario Kart' and 'Need for Speed' offer a more accessible and immediate thrill. These games prioritize fun over realism, introducing fantastical elements such as power-ups, wild track designs, and exaggerated physics. They create a more casual, albeit equally exhilarating, racing experience that appeals to a broad audience, from families enjoying game night to friends competing for bragging rights.

The advent of online multiplayer has also transformed the racing genre, allowing players to compete against friends or strangers from around the world. Games such as 'iRacing' and 'F1 2023' incorporate robust online components, fostering communities around shared interests and competitive spirit. The chance to race head-to-head against real opponents, with rankings and leaderboards adding an extra layer of challenge, has only intensified the allure of racing games.

Moreover, technological advancements continue to push the boundaries of what racing games can achieve. Virtual reality, for instance, offers an unprecedented level of immersion, allowing players to experience the visceral thrill of racing in an entirely new way. The sensation of truly being in the driver's seat, with a 360-degree view of the race environment, marks an exciting evolution in the genre.
